Austen owns seven-sixteenths of a jewelry store. The total investment for the store was $832,000. What is the value of Austen’s share of the business?

$364,000

Three partners are investing a total of $1,200,000 in a new restaurant. Their investments are in the ratio of 6:8:11. How much did each invest?

$288,000; $384,000; and $528,000

A partnership owned by 25 partners is worth 5.4 million dollars. The partnership loses a lawsuit worth 6.2 million dollars. How much of the settlement is each partner liable for after the partnership is sold? 

Partners are personally liable, so $800,000 needs to be paid in the lawsuit. Each partner must pay $32,000.

The Barnaby Corporation issued 2,700,000 shares of stock at its beginning to shareholders. How many shares must a shareowner own to have a majority of the shares?

1,350,001

Fifty-five and one-half percent of the shareholders in a fast food chain are under the age of 40. If the corporation is owned by 86,000 investors, how many of the shareholders are 40 and over?

38,270
